已开发项目效果实现截图

同行可拿货,招校园代理
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

项目介绍

本课题基于协同过滤算法,系统实现的主要功能包括首页、个人中心、用户管理、商品分类管理、商品信息管理、交流论坛、留言板、系统管理、订单管理等功能的操作主要采用nodejs技术和MySQL数据库技术以及vue框架进行开发。功能主要包括首页、个人中心、用户管理、商品分类管理、商品信息管理、交流论坛、留言板、系统管理、订单管理等功能,从而实现个性化智能体育商品推荐方式,提高个性化智能体育商品推荐的效率。 相比于传统的体育商品推荐方式,个性化智能的管理方式可以大幅提高体育商品推荐的管理效率,实现了个性化智能体育商品推荐的标准化、制度化、程序化的管理,有效地防止了体育商品推荐的随意管理,提高了信息的处理速度和精确度,能够及时、准确地查询和修正个性化智能体育商品推荐情况等信息。通过对体育商品推荐内容的学习研究,进而设计并实现一个基于协同过滤算法的个性化智能体育商品推荐系统。

开发语言:Python
框架:flask/django
开发软件:PyCharm/vscode
数据库:mysql
数据库工具:Navicat for mysql
Echarts有着与众不同的特点和惊艳全场的视觉效果,Echarts有以下几种特点:
1、开源软件,并且提供了非常炫酷的图形界面,还有各种直观的数据分析图形
2、使用简单,软件本身已经封装了js,只要引用到位就会有得到完美展示
3、兼容性好,基于html5,有着良好的动画渲染效果。
4、多种数据格式无需转换直接使用,对与直接传入包括二维表,key-value表等多种格式的数据源,通过简单的设置encode属性就可以完成从数据到图形的映射,这使Mysql的数据更容易的被引用
hadoop集群技术
Hadoop是一个分布式系统的基础框架,用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力进行高速运算和存储。Hadoop的框架最核心的设计就是:HDFS和MapReduce。Hadoop实现了一个分布式文件系统,简称HDFS。HDFS有高容错性的特点,并且设计用来部署在低廉的硬件上;而且它提供高吞吐量来访问应用程序的数据,适合那些有着超大数据集的应用程序。HDFS放宽了POSIX的要求,可以以流的形式访问文件系统中的数据。
同时Hadoop有着高可靠性、高拓展性、高效性、高容错性的特点,非常适合于此次题目的使用

核心代码参考示例

预测算法代码如下(示例):

def booksinfoforecast_forecast():
    import datetime
    if request.method in ["POST", "GET"]:#get、post请求
        msg = {'code': normal_code, 'message': 'success'}
        #获取数据集
        req_dict = session.get("req_dict")
        connection = pymysql.connect(**mysql_config)
        query = "SELECT author,type,status,wordcount, monthcount FROM booksinfo"
        #处理缺失值
        data = pd.read_sql(query, connection).dropna()
        id = req_dict.pop('id',None)
        req_dict.pop('addtime',None)
        df = to_forecast(data,req_dict,None)
        #创建数据库连接,将DataFrame 插入数据库
        connection_string = f"mysql+pymysql://{mysql_config['user']}:{mysql_config['password']}@{mysql_config['host']}:{mysql_config['port']}/{mysql_config['database']}"
        engine = create_engine(connection_string)
        try:
            if req_dict :
                #遍历 DataFrame,并逐行更新数据库
                with engine.connect() as connection:
                    for index, row in df.iterrows():
                        sql = """
                        INSERT INTO booksinfoforecast (id
                        ,monthcount
                        )
                        VALUES (%(id)s
                    ,%(monthcount)s
                        )
                        ON DUPLICATE KEY UPDATE
                        monthcount = VALUES(monthcount)
                        """
                        connection.execute(sql, {'id': id
                            , 'monthcount': row['monthcount']
                        })
            else:
                df.to_sql('booksinfoforecast', con=engine, if_exists='append', index=False)
            print("数据更新成功!")
        except Exception as e:
            print(f"发生错误: {e}")
        finally:
            engine.dispose()  # 关闭数据库连接
        return jsonify(msg)
 

其他题目推荐

个人物品管理系统_9u591z4y_论文
中华历史故事展播系统的设计与实现_6s872fp0_论文
乡村信息管理系统_rp50aq26_论文
企业数据资产登记系统_6op56dox_论文
企业采购管理系统的设计与实现_oiwz03rl_zl062
健康菜谱生成系统_91063583_没论文
医疗设备维护平台_医院设备维修系统za112o22–论文
医院就诊管理系统_j1xc967h_在线问诊系统
协同过滤算法 音乐推荐系统_731w447o 论坛 浏览历史
博客网站的设计与实现_7m652q36_论文 三角色 聊天
基于Vue.js的社区服务平台_hhwf9j74_gk003
基于Web的家庭设备维修服务系统_z213he91_没论文
基于大数据的水产品安全信息管理系统_wj6214t2 可视化大屏系统
大型商场应急预案管理系统_8cpiab4r_论文
大学生勤工助学系统_pxu0wjg0
大学生实习与就业管理系统_8d6m43dj–论文
宠物交易管理平台设计与实现_04x6x02h论文
家政保洁预约系统_mwrnnvi8_论文 角色多
小型家政服务管理系统的实现与设计_eb0c0cla
尿毒症肾病健康管理系统的设计与实现_o9l85503_论文
房产租赁管理系统_二手房屋租赁系统s611188f–论文
旅游民宿营销系统_r07n6c81_论文
智能在线预约挂号系统_mf46sa6p_ c017
智能社区物业管理系统 智汇家园管理系统_12849c0x–论文
林业资源开发管理系统设计与实现1_2595688s–论文
校园二手闲置物品租售系统_fua5h997
档案数字化项目沟通协作管理系统_hjn93g7q_论文
植物绿植盆景销售商城管理系统的设计与实现_byn179m2_gk003
河南传统文化的展示与交流网站平台的设计与实现_142d83lu_论文
油田土地档案管理系统_u0vz7897
电子政务服务预约管理系统_n3kl9t44_论文
电脑商城系统的设计与实现_zyc9c7kh–论文
社区助老志愿管理服务平台的开发_s79qt96d_lx001
社区闲置物品交易求购系统_n63346eq_论文
绥大学生学习平台管理系统的设计与实现_7j8l5kdg
网上图书销售商城 躲猫猫书店运营管理系统_图书采购系统4uzahw74–论文
钱币收藏交流系统的设计与实现_31iopgl9_论文
顺丰快递公司物流仓储管理信息系统的开发与应用_6j7op54a_论文
高校科研管理系统-纵向项目管理_qfny8987–论文
高校竞赛管理系统_bt73sj1m_zl026

总结

在这个大数据的时代,年轻人都习惯于从互联网上获得信息。我们将更清晰更有效的消息分享给年轻人。提升用户的体验我也希望这次的设计能通过我后期的自主学习把它趋向于完美,成为我的自主创作经验。 原始数据中存在异常值、重复值、系统自动推荐等数据,这部分数据价值含量低、数据结构混乱,严重影响数据挖掘模型的执行效率,导致挖掘结果的偏差,所以进行数据清洗是必不可少的。结合原始数据的具体情况,数据预处理采用文本去重、机械压缩去词和短句删除
(1)网络爬虫模块
(2)关系数据库模块
(3)用户注册登录权限模块
(4)数据统计分析模块
(5)Django后台服务
(6)前端渲染可视化模块

源码获取详细视频演示或者查看其他版本:文章底部获取博主联系方式!

需要成品或者定制,加我们的时候,不满意的可以定制
文章最下方名片联系我即可~ 所有项目都经过测试完善,本系统包修改时间和标题,包安装部署运行调试

Logo

有“AI”的1024 = 2048,欢迎大家加入2048 AI社区

更多推荐